Abstract

An apparatus for operating on tissue includes an elongate shaft extending distally from a body and an end effector at a distal end of the elongate shaft. The end effector includes a first jaw that is selectively pivotable toward and away from a second jaw to capture tissue and a firing beam. The firing beam is configured to advance relative to the first and second jaws to sever captured tissue and retract relative to the first and second jaws after the captured tissue has been severed. The apparatus further includes a debris removal element in communication with the firing beam. The debris removal element is configured to engage at least a portion of the firing beam at least during retraction of the firing beam relative to the first and second jaws to thereby remove at least some debris from the firing beam.
